About This Food Place

Mantequilla Hipódromo is a charming breakfast restaurant located on Av. Tapachula in Chapultepec Este, Tijuana. Known for its cozy and trendy atmosphere, this spot blends casual dining with high-quality food offerings including coffee, cocktails, and quick bites. Visitors appreciate the great coffee and desserts, making it a popular destination for a relaxed breakfast or brunch experience.

With a solid rating of 4.3 from over a thousand reviews, it attracts college students, tourists, and groups looking to enjoy a peaceful morning or early afternoon meal. The restaurant offers outdoor seating alongside dine-in, takeout, and delivery options, catering to various preferences in a setting designed for comfort and quality.

JD
John Damberger 2 month ago

"A bit expensive for my cheap ass, @100 to200 peso plates, rich area to be expected. food served slow but menu warns you 15-35min, 2 plates in 10min last one in 20. All gringo safe, chillecilles have a gringo safe spicy kick. All plates good quality, but not large for quantity. Parking could be difficult at peak times. Free WiFi. If you are a drunk, 199 peso bottomless mimosas, I saw them mix them strong. Caliente race track across the street, spend you winnings here, not you hard earned money."

MMS
Manuel Melo Sanchez 3 month ago

"I was in Mantequilla for breakfast. The food is tasty and the portions are good, the staff is friendly and the atmosphere is quite enjoyable. We had the birria kiles and the French toast and they were really tasty. It is not a place to come and eat in a rush since service is not particularly fast. Even if they have valet parking, parking can be tricky when the place is full."

IJ
IJ Jordan 3 month ago

"Mexican Cafe in the morning, and they close around 1pm. A Japanese restaurant in the noon. They are known for their sushi. We ordered tempura, salmon bento, and classic ramen. The salmon bento is really good. We also recommend the tempura. The ramen lacks body but good basic soup. They have valet parking since parking is limited."

JG
J G 4 month ago

"Awesome experience today Saturday at Mantequilla Breakfast in Tijuana, Mexico! Parking is definitely challenging, not many options, I recommend their valet parking service if you don’t know the area (I don’t know the area either lol.) Staff were nice and welcoming, giving some excellent recommendations for our first time. Patio seating and inside seating available. Nice relaxing atmosphere, very pleasant, and not too loud! Food was delicious! My wife and her friend got the chilaquiles, I ordered the shrimp omelette. And fresh squeezed orange juice. Loved it! Prices were between 200-300 Mex Pesos ($10-$15 USD). Pay in Mexican pesos if possible, you’ll avoid the exchange fee! Definitely recommended!"
